} printf("排序好的数据是:");for(int i=0;i<5;i++){ printf("a[%d]=%d\n",i,a[i]);} max=a[1];printf("次最大值为:%d",max);return 0;} 运行结果如图1所示。图1
在这种情况下,数组中的元素值分别为10、5、20,其他元素的值可以根据需要进行补充。 综上所述,我们已经成功定义了一个名为"numbers"的一维整型数组,并将五个待排序的数存储在数组中。在接下来的部分,我们将介绍如何对该数组进行从大到小的排序操作。 2.2输入五个数: 为了实现从大到小排序,首先需要输入五个整数...
int a[5];for (int i = 0; i < 5; i++)scanf_s("%d", &a[i]);sort(a,5);printf("次最大值=%d", a[1]);}
定义一维整型数组,输..定义一维整型数组,输入5个数,从大到小排序,输出次最大值。求大神告知,怎么写。。。有大佬给个过程嘛,感激不尽。。。
定义一个包括10个元素一维整型数组,通过从键盘输入的10个整数对数组进行初始化,对数组中的元素按小到大排序后在屏幕上显示,求出该数组中元素的最小值、最大值以及平均值并在屏幕上显示输出。 import java.util.Scanner; import java.util.Arrays; public class Test{ public static void main(String[] args) {...